Skip to content

pablobion/vite-plugin-ssr

Repository files navigation

Sistema de Internacionalização com Vite + SSR

Vite React vite-plugin-ssr Tailwind CSS

Um projeto moderno de aplicação web com internacionalização completa, Server-Side Rendering (SSR), Static Site Generation (SSG) e SEO otimizado usando Vite, React e vite-plugin-ssr.

✨ Características Principais

�� Internacionalização (i18n)

  • 3 idiomas suportados: Português (pt-BR), Inglês (en-US), Espanhol (es-ES)
  • URLs específicas por idioma: /pt/exemplo, /en/exemplo, /es/exemplo
  • Detecção automática de idioma via URL
  • Traduções dinâmicas com fallback estático para SSG
  • Hreflang tags para SEO internacional

Performance e SEO

  • Server-Side Rendering (SSR) para carregamento rápido
  • Static Site Generation (SSG) para deploy estático
  • Sitemap XML automático com prioridades inteligentes
  • Meta tags otimizadas por idioma
  • URLs canônicas corretas

🎨 Interface Moderna

  • Tailwind CSS para estilização utilitária
  • Design responsivo e mobile-first
  • Componentes reutilizáveis em React
  • Navegação fluida entre idiomas

🚀 Início Rápido

Pré-requisitos

  • Node.js 16+
  • npm ou yarn

Instalação

# Clone o repositório
git clone <url-do-repositorio>
cd 4generate

# Instale as dependências
npm install

# Execute em modo desenvolvimento
npm run dev

Scripts Disponíveis

# Desenvolvimento
npm run dev          # Servidor de desenvolvimento

# Produção
npm run build        # Build para produção
npm run prod         # Build + servidor de produção

# Qualidade de código
npm run lint         # ESLint

About

vite ssr + tailwind + i18n BLANK

Resources

Stars

Watchers

Forks

Releases

No releases published

Packages

 
 
 

Contributors